    Breaking Barriers: Why Women Are Pedaling in Gyms but Hesitant to Hit the Streets

    Despite the growing popularity of indoor cycling among women, many remain hesitant to ride outdoors. Experts cite intimidation and the fear of being the only woman on the road as significant barriers. Addressing these concerns could encourage more female cyclists.
